Learn more about Tomintoul

Nestled in the Cairngorms National Park, this Highland village offers whisky tastings at the Tomintoul Distillery and scenic hiking trails for all abilities. Explore the Glenlivet Estate nearby for mountain biking adventures or visit the Tomintoul Museum to discover fascinating local history.

Best time to go to Tomintoul

The best time to visit Tomintoul is dependent on what kind of holiday you are seeking. July is its hottest month on average. At this time, visitor numbers are slightly high and weather is mostly cloudy with light rain. January is its coolest month on average. At this time, visitor numbers are average and weather is mostly cloudy with light rain.

calendar iconCalendar Monthtemperature iconTemperaturerain iconPrecipitationmostly cloudy iconCloudinessoccupation rate iconOccupancyprice iconPricing
January34.2°F (1.2°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ly Low
February35.1°F (1.7°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
March37.6°F (3.1°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ly Low
April41.7°F (5.4°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ly HighAverage
May46.8°F (8.2°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ly LowAverage
June52.2°F (11.2°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ly High
July54.9°F (12.7°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ly HighSlightly High
August53.8°F (12.1°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ly High
September50.7°F (10.4°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
October45.0°F (7.2°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ly LowAverage
November39.4°F (4.1°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ly LowSlightly Low
December35.2°F (1.8°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ly HighAverage

What's the seasonal weather like in Tomintoul?
The hottest months are usually July and August, with an average temperature of 12°C, while the coldest months are January and February, with an average of 2°C. Average annual precipitation for Tomintoul is 1031 mm.
